Helicopters to Fly Over West Campus Today

Flight paths a part of training exercise

Duke community members may look to the sky and hear loud noises over West Campus this afternoon.

At around 3 p.m. today, the National Guard will fly Apache helicopters over Wallace Wade Stadium as part of a training exercise for the Dec. 14 Army-Navy football game. The event, which is expected to last about eight minutes, will feature helicopters flying two flight patterns at about 500 feet over West Campus.

The exercise has received approval by both the Federal Aviation Administration and Duke administrators.

According to the American Tinnitus Association, a non-profit organization that works to fund research for the auditory dysfunction, Apache helicopters produce a noise level of about 100 decibels. That level is equivalent to noises like hearing a power saw three feet away or a nearby motorcycle. Noise levels for those on campus will vary, depending on location, surrounding area and whether they're indoors, among other environmental aspects.
